Transport & Vehicles in Toogoolawah

How households get around — the vehicles they keep and the journey to work.

Far fewer people work from home in Toogoolawah than in the rest of the country, with only 9.3% doing so. This is a car-dependent area where most residents rely on private vehicles to get around and reach employment.

Vehicles

Motor vehicles per home, and homes with no car.

Most homes have at least one car, though 5.3% of households have no motor vehicle. This is much higher than most similar areas, but it is about the same as the Queensland figure.

In Toogoolawah, the largest group is 1 vehicle at 42%, followed by 2 vehicles (33%) and 3 vehicles (14%).

Getting to work

How people travel to work.

Driving is the main way to get to work for 58.7% of people, while 9.5% walk. Very few residents use public transport for their commute, at just 1.2%, which is well below the national figure.

Public transport access

Stops, services, routes and how far you can get by public transport.

There is only one public transport route and stop in the area, both of which are buses. While this is more than some similar areas, the 10 weekly departures per 1,000 people is far below the Queensland average.

Getting around

Walking distance to transport and driving time to the city.

The walk to the nearest transport stop is short, taking only 5 minutes, which is lower than most areas. It typically takes 81 minutes to drive to the city.
